Reward fund created for Malden shooting victim

Posted: 02/04/13 at 7:00 pm EST

MALDEN, Mass. (WHDH) -- The owner of Beantown Collectibles in Boston has set up a fund for Shawn Clark, the Marine who was fatally shot in Malden last week.

Sly Edidio set up the reward fund and has put forward a $5,000 initial reward with his company. To contribute to the reward fund, you can go to any Peoples United Bank and tell them you want to contribute to the Shawn Clark reward fund.

The fund was created in hopes of raising enough money so anyone with information about the shooting will come forward. No arrests have been made.
